An Old Fashioned Girl is a novel by Louisa May Alcott that was first serialized in the magazine Merry’s Museum between July and August on 1869. The story centers on a 14 year old country girl named Polly Milton as she visits her wealthy cousin Fanny Shaw in the city for the first time. As expected, the grandiose and hectic lifestyle of the city quickly overwhelms young Polly as she is accustomed to the simple country life. Polly initially had difficulty socializing with the people in the city, even Fanny finds Polly’s ways a bit unusual. Fanny’s friends reject her and her family members are quite disconcerted with her personality.
However, Polly’s warmth and kindness slowly wins over everyone around her and maybe it is high time for her to teach them some old fashioned lessons and values. Six years later, Polly will once again venture into the city but this time to realize her dream of becoming a music teacher. She will discover the hardships of this profession which will test her mettle. During this time, Polly would also find out that the Shaw’s are nearing bankruptcy and it is once again time for her to step in and show them that material effects are not really essential when it comes to having a happy and content family.
